Transaction 2500a4956a2849975e14ce64d2aab6c59786a3c3b47dd50fd264d7a0c193560e

1 Input
2 Outputs
  • 2500a4956a2849975e14ce64d2aab6c59786a3c3b47dd50fd264d7a0c193560e:0
  • value  3586000
    address  1CVS8n6AEHt3Ax2hCcyn3eFmFftqn6HjWt
  • 2500a4956a2849975e14ce64d2aab6c59786a3c3b47dd50fd264d7a0c193560e:1
  • value  15393
    address  141xGDFcAPw89htmxqmE8d88ELBsf1ahde